On Education.com, First grade syllable resources provide tools for teaching young learners how to recognize, clap, and count syllables. These resources help students build foundational phonics skills by exploring open and closed syllables and applying simple division rules such as VCCV, V/CV, and VC/V. Materials include interactive games, printable worksheets, and hands-on activities that make learning engaging and accessible. Using these resources supports early reading success and phonemic awareness.

Educators and parents can access a variety of First grade syllables lesson plans, number-sorted worksheets, and practice exercises to reinforce sound recognition and decoding skills. Interactive content like clapping and syllable sorting games helps students practice counting syllables in fun, meaningful ways. This wide selection of materials allows children to strengthen their phonological awareness, improve literacy, and gain confidence in reading both complex and familiar words.
